PayU integration by Krzysztof Gzocha
  • Namespace
  • Class

Namespaces

  • Team3
    • PayU
      • Annotation
      • Communication
        • CurlRequestBuilder
        • HttpStatusParser
        • Notification
        • Process
          • NotificationProcess
          • ResponseDeserializer
        • Request
          • Model
        • Response
          • Model
        • Sender
      • Configuration
        • Credentials
      • Order
        • Autocomplete
          • Strategy
        • Model
          • Buyer
          • Money
          • Products
          • ShippingMethods
          • Traits
        • Transformer
          • UserOrder
            • Strategy
              • Product
              • ShippingMethod
      • PropertyExtractor
        • Reader
      • Serializer
      • SignatureCalculator
        • Encoder
          • Algorithms
          • Strategy
        • ParametersSorter
        • Validator
      • ValidatorBuilder

Classes

  • CurlRequestBuilder

Interfaces

  • CurlRequestBuilderInterface

Namespace Team3\PayU\Communication\CurlRequestBuilder

Classes summary

CurlRequestBuilder

This library is using two types of request. First type is PayuRequestInterface and second is \Buzz\Message\Request. Responsibility of this class is to transform simple Team3\PayU\Communication\Request\PayURequestInterface into \Buzz\Message\Request with given Team3\PayU\Configuration\ConfigurationInterface

Interfaces summary

CurlRequestBuilderInterface

This library is using two types of request. First type is PayuRequestInterface and second is \Buzz\Message\Request. Responsibility of this class is to transform simple Team3\PayU\Communication\Request\PayURequestInterface into \Buzz\Message\Request with given Team3\PayU\Configuration\ConfigurationInterface

PayU integration by Krzysztof Gzocha API documentation generated by ApiGen